Transaction 81f03872ba5d85a8531250669b7f82fd41db9d9ab5b984801e0577e307865581
1 Input
1 Output
-
81f03872ba5d85a8531250669b7f82fd41db9d9ab5b984801e0577e307865581:0
- value
- 2798486
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 81a8c94df9048429997ef5de38eb39a84aa8afeb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CpaNEAme8Mietyxjs4fZDYiDQ3ZgwZRQA